Незмінність є основоположною та однією з найважливіших властивостей технології блокчейн. Вона полягає в тому, що після запису даних у блокчейн їх неможливо змінити чи видалити, що гарантує цілісність і достовірність інформації. Ця характеристика забезпечується поєднанням криптографічних хеш-функцій, механізмів консенсусу та технології розподіленого реєстру, завдяки чому блокчейн виступає захищеною системою зберігання даних, ідеальною для випадків, де потрібна максимальна довіра та прозорість.
Ідея незмінності виникла з документації Bitcoin, опублікованої Сатоші Накамото у 2008 році, хоча термін «незмінний» безпосередньо не згадувався. У документі було описано електронну валютну систему, що дозволяє уникати подвійного витрачання без посередництва довірених третіх сторін. Основу цієї властивості становить поєднання ланцюгової структури блоків і механізму доказу роботи (proof-of-work), що гарантує практично неможливість зміни записів про транзакції після їх підтвердження і додавання до блокчейну.
З розвитком технології блокчейн незмінність була визнана ключовою перевагою розподіленого реєстру, і її застосування поширилося на сфери, що виходять за межі фінансових операцій, зокрема на відстеження ланцюгів постачання, електронне голосування, верифікацію особи та захист інтелектуальної власності. Незмінність забезпечує цим галузям безпрецедентні гарантії цілісності даних.
Незмінність забезпечується завдяки кільком рівням технічного захисту:
Криптографічні хеш-ланцюги: Кожен блок містить хеш-значення попереднього блоку, формуючи безперервний ланцюг. Будь-яка зміна у вмісті блоку змінює його хеш-значення, що впливає на всі наступні блоки й робить підробку очевидною.
Механізми консенсусу: Вузли блокчейн-мережі мають узгоджувати дійсність транзакцій та порядок блоків. Консенсусні алгоритми, такі як доказ роботи (proof-of-work) і доказ частки (proof-of-stake), гарантують, що зміна історичних записів потребує контролю над більшістю вузлів, що в масштабних мережах практично неможливо.
Розподілене зберігання: Повні копії реєстру блокчейну розподіляються між багатьма вузлами мережі, кожен з яких може перевірити валідність транзакцій і блоків. Така дублювання у зберіганні унеможливлює атаки на один вузол.
Мітки часу та підтвердження блоків: З додаванням нових блоків попередні блоки стають все більш недоступними для зміни. Для цього потрібно перерахувати всі наступні блоки, а обчислювальні витрати зростають експоненціально.
Хоча незмінність є ключовою перевагою блокчейну, вона створює певні виклики:
Незворотність помилок: Якщо помилкові дані потрапили у блокчейн, їх майже неможливо виправити. Це ускладнює роботу застосунків, що мають виправляти помилки або відповідати вимогам, як «право на забуття».
Ризик атаки 51%: Теоретично, якщо зловмисник контролює понад 50 % обчислювальної потужності мережі, він може переписати історію блокчейну, хоча такі атаки дуже дорогі у великих мережах.
Регуляторні вимоги: Незмінність може суперечити нормам захисту персональних даних, наприклад вимогам GDPR щодо права на видалення даних.
Ефективність зберігання: Зберігання повної копії блокчейну на кожному вузлі викликає постійне зростання обсягу даних.
Відповідь через жорстке розгалуження (hard fork): У крайніх випадках блокчейн-спільнота може застосувати жорстке розгалуження для «модифікації» історії, як це сталося після атаки на DAO в Ethereum, однак це створює новий ланцюг, а не змінює оригінальний.
Попри ці виклики, блокчейн-спільнота розробляє різноманітні рішення — позаланцюгове (off-chain) зберігання, перевірювані структури даних, технології захисту приватності — щоб зберегти фундаментальну властивість незмінності.
Незмінність — одна з найреволюційніших переваг технології блокчейн, що забезпечує нові механізми довіри у цифровому середовищі. Вона дозволяє досягати консенсусу щодо достовірності та цілісності даних без централізованого контролю. Гарантуючи, що записані дані не можна змінити в односторонньому порядку, блокчейн створює перевірювану, прозору та захищену систему обліку, яка стає основою довіри для фінансових операцій, управління ланцюгами постачання, систем голосування, цифрової ідентифікації тощо. Незважаючи на технічні й регуляторні виклики, незмінність залишається центральною цінністю блокчейну й надалі стимулюватиме впровадження та розвиток рішень, що потребують максимального рівня довіри й цілісності даних.
Поділіться